Marilyn Manson faces fresh lawsuit over claims he ‘groomed and sexually assaulted’ underage girl multiple times in the 1990s
Marilyn Manson is being sued for allegedly grooming and assaulting an underage girl multiple times in the 1990s, according to a new lawsuit.
The singer has previously been sued and accused of sexual misconduct from around 2010.
Manson is listed as a defendant alongside his former labels Interscope and Nothing Records, with the plaintiff submitting it anonymously.
It is the first lawsuit against the singer, focusing on a sex crime that took place at the beginning of his career.

The lawsuit includes counts of sexual battery and intentional inflictions of emotional distress against Manson, real name Brian Warner.
It was filed in Nassau County Supreme Court on Long Island, with negligence and intentional infliction of emotional distress being levered against the labels.
